Heather Wilson-Robles, DVM, DACVIM (Oncology), associate professor in the veterinary medicine and biomedical sciences department at Texas A&M University, explains how canine lymphoma and human lymphoma are very similar. Humans don’t usually get the small cell GI lymphomas that cats get, but being FIV positive is similar to HIV viral infections, she says.
